Start your day with a romantic walk along the Marine Drive Promenade, also known as the Queen's Necklace. Enjoy the stunning views of the Arabian Sea and the impressive skyline.
Visit the iconic Gateway of India monument, built during the British Raj in 1924. Take a ferry to Elephanta Caves or explore the architecture of the Taj Mahal Palace Hotel located opposite the Gateway.

Visit the U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the busiest railway stations in India, Chhatrapati Shivaji Terminus. Marvel at the Victorian-Gothic architecture and the intricate details on the facade.
Explore the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Elephanta Caves, a collection of cave temples dedicated to Lord Shiva. Admire the intricate carvings, statues, and sculptures.
